Since 2008, Asking Alexandria, formed and based in the U.K., have paved a path of their own, distilling danger and excess into an equally dangerous hybrid of stadium rock ambition, metallic energy, and electronic ecstasy. Against all odds, they achieved unprecedented success earmarked by two gold-certified singles (namely, âFinal Episode (Letâs Change The Channel)â and âNot The American Averageâ), over a billion cumulative streams and views, and three consecutive top 10 debuts on the Billboard Top 200âReckless & Relentless [2011], From Death to Destiny [2013], and The Black [2016]. In addition to headlining packed gigs on five continents, they destroyed stages alongside Guns Nâ Roses, Green Day, Avenged Sevenfold, Alice In Chains and Slipknot, to name a few. Meanwhile, 2017âs self-titled Asking Alexandria spawned two of the groupâs biggest singles to date: âAlone In A Roomâ (40 million Spotify streams) and âInto the Fireâ (30 million Spotify streams).
The quintetâBen Bruce [guitar, backing vocals], Danny Worsnop [lead vocals], James Cassells [drums], Cameron Liddell [guitar], and Sam Bettley [bass]â saw their first-ever #1 at U.S. radio with the single âAlone Again,â taken from their latest critically acclaimed album See Whatâs On The Inside and a second Top 10 single âNever Gonna Learnâ (#6). The band were also featured on the soundtrack for Better Noise Filmâs 2022 horror-thriller The Retaliators with the track âFaded Out (feat. Within Temptation),â and on the collaborative theme song âThe Retaliators Theme (21 Bullets)â alongside Motley Crue, Ice Nine Kills and From Ashes to New. Worsnop also appeared as a guest on Hyro The Heroâs âWhoâs That Playing On The Radioâ in addition to Mick Mars.
